Ticketmaster Eliminates Fees To Sell Taylor Swift Tickets

Taylor Swift

Taylor Swift’s people want you to believe her “reputation” tour is selling well, despite plenty of tickets still being available. In fact, there are so many tickets still available  that Ticketmaster recently ran a promotion to try and move some.

Earlier this week, Ticketmaster launched a special promotion that actually waved service fees for her shows in connection with tax day. The promotion ended yesterday, but fans lucky enough to snag tickets saved around 19%.

And it sounds like fans may have even more options to get cheaper tickets to the shows. Currently the cheapest tickets on the secondary market are going for about $66, compared with $102 for her “1989” tour. Plus there are currently 35% more tickets on the secondary market than there were at this time for “1989.”

And fans don’t even need to go to secondary markets for tickets. Ticketmaster shows there are plenty of seats available for all 40 of her North American dates.

Taylor Swift’s “reputation World Tour” kicks off May 8th in Phoenix, Arizona.
